Studying Online at Iowa Western Community College
Distance learning is available at Iowa Western Community College. Among 5,540 students, 1,633 (29%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 1,886 (34%) took at least some classes online.

Top-Paying Careers for General Accounting Graduates
Those who complete General Accounting program at Iowa Western Community College pursue many career paths. Here are the best-paid careers for General Accounting majors, ordered by median annual salary:
| Occupation | Nationwide Median Wage |
|---|---|
| Financial Risk Specialists | $127,364 |
| Appraisers of Personal and Business Property | $118,242 |
| Financial Examiners | $117,139 |
| Budget Analysts | $80,859 |
| Accountants and Auditors | $79,222 |
| Tax Examiners and Collectors, and Revenue Agents | $77,212 |
| Tax Preparers | $67,542 |
| Credit Analysts | $66,233 |
